-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第11章 数据库应用38798
《Java程序设计实用教程(第3版)》 ResultSet接口支持数据敏感和可更新功能的方法 void updateRow() throws SQLException; void insertRow() throws SQLException; void deleteRow() throws SQLException; 3. 通过ResultSet结果集更新表 《Java程序设计实用教程(第3版)》 作业和实验12 作业:P339页习题11 P339:6、7、8、11、13、16、17题 实验12: 1、P340:(2)题 2、P340:(3)题 《Java程序设计实用教程(第3版)》 实验11 数据库应用设计 目的:设计JDBC数据库应用程序。 要求:了解JDBC数据库驱动程序类型,熟悉JDBC提供的接口和类,掌握指定驱动类型、连接数据库、执行SQL语句、处理结果集等操作方法,进一步理解Java接口机制的作用。 重点:连接数据库、执行SQL语句、处理结果集。 难点:执行SQL语句、处理结果集。 《Java程序设计实用教程(第3版)》 第11章 数据库应用 11.1 关系数据库系统 11.2 JDBC 《Java程序设计实用教程(第3版)》 11.1 关系数据库系统 11.1.1 数据库系统 11.1.2 关系模型 11.1.3 客户-服务器结构的关系数据库系统 11.1.4 结构化查询语言SQL 11.1.5 Access数据库 11.1.6 MySQL数据库* 《Java程序设计实用教程(第3版)》 11.1.1 数据库系统 数据库(DB) 数据库管理系统(DBMS) 数据库系统(DBS) 《Java程序设计实用教程(第3版)》 11.1.2 关系模型 数据描述中的术语 实体、实体集、实体的属性 数据模型 数据结构、数据操作和数据完整性约束 《Java程序设计实用教程(第3版)》 1. 关系模型的数据结构 关系:二维表,列、行。 关系的性质 主键与外键 关系模式 关系(列{,列}) 学生(学号,姓名,性别,省份,地区,出生年月,民族,团员) 课程(课程号,课程名,学分,学时) 学生成绩(学号,课程号,成绩) 11.1.2 关系模型 《Java程序设计实用教程(第3版)》 2. 关系模型的数据操纵和数据完整性规则 实体完整性规则 参照完整性规则 用户定义的完整性规则 11.1.2 关系模型 11.1.3 客户-服务器结构的关系数据库系统 数据库的结构与功能分布 2. 数据库连接 3.数据库应用程序 数据库连接技术分类 ODBC 11.1.3 客户-服务器结构的关系数据库系统 《Java程序设计实用教程(第3版)》 11.1.4 结构化查询语言SQL SQL数据库的体系结构 SQL的特点与组成 表11-2 SQL语言的动词 SQL功能 动 词 说 明 数据定义 CREATE、DROP、ALTER 创建表、删除表、修改表 数据操纵 INSERT、UPDATE、DELETE 插入、更新、删除 数据查询 SELECT 查询 数据控制 GRANT、REVOKE 授予权限、收回权限 《Java程序设计实用教程(第3版)》 3. 数据定义 (1)创建基本表 CREATE TABLE 基本表 (列 数据类型 [列级完整性约束] {,列 数据类型 [列级完整性约束]} [,表级完整性约束]) 11.1.4 结构化查询语言SQL 《Java程序设计实用教程(第3版)》 (2)修改基本表 ALTER TABLE 基本表 [ADD 新列 数据类型 [列级完整性约束]] [MODIFY 列 数据类型] [DROP 完整性约束] (3)删除表 DROP TABLE 表 11.1.4 结构化查询语言SQL 《Java程序设计实用教程(第3版)》 4. 数据更新 (1)插入数据 INSERT INTO 基本表 [(列1{, 列2})] VALUES(值1{, 值2}) (2)修改数据 UPDATE 基本表 SET 列 = 表达式{,列 = 表达式} [WHERE 条件表达式] (3)删除数据 DELETE FROM 表 [WHERE 条件表达式] 11.1.4 结构化查询语言SQL 《Java程序设计实用教程(第3版)》 5. 数据查询 SELECT语句语法 SELECT [ALL | DISTINCT] 列表达式 {,列表达式} FROM 表 [WHERE 条件表达式] [GROUP BY 列 [HAVING 条件表达式]] [ORDER BY 列 [
您可能关注的文档
- 第07章 妊娠期并发症妇女的护理30749.ppt
- 第07章 异常分娩妇女的护理.ppt
- 第07章 流转税制38187.ppt
- 第09讲 机械制造工艺概念与工艺规程48190.ppt
- 第10章 数据库应用38428.ppt
- 第11章 异常产褥修改后.ppt
- 第11章换药_外科护理学33768.ppt
- 第12章 机械工程材料.ppt
- 第12章 数据库应用系统开发35525.ppt
- 第12章腹部疾病——第11节 胆道疾病高职高专《外科学》(第二版)ppt课件.ppt
- 第12章腹部疾病——第1节腹外疝高职高专《外科学》(第二版)ppt课件.ppt
- 第12章腹部疾病——第2节急性腹膜炎高职高专《外科学》(第二版)ppt课件.ppt
- 第12章腹部疾病——第3节腹部损伤高职高专《外科学》(第二版)ppt课件.ppt
- 第12章腹部疾病——第4节胃、十二指肠溃疡的外科治疗高职高专《外科学》(第二版)ppt课件.ppt
- 第12章腹部疾病——第5节胃 癌高职高专《外科学》(第二版)ppt课件.ppt
最近下载
- 2024年10月27日云南昭通市事业单位选调笔试真题及答案解析.doc VIP
- 讲义总结岩土工程勘察讲义.ppt VIP
- 非常规油气勘探开发地质风险评估.pdf
- 中职 图形图像处理(Photoshop CS5)PS(第7章)教学课件 高教版.ppt VIP
- 市政道路监理规划-范本.pdf VIP
- 2025海南省通信网络技术保障中心招聘事业编制人员12人(第1号)笔试模拟试题及答案解析.docx VIP
- 《飞机上应急医疗》课件——心肺复苏的流程.pptx VIP
- 中职 图形图像处理(Photoshop CS5)PS(第6章)教学课件 高教版.ppt VIP
- 抖音直播社区公约.pdf VIP
- 地质灾害治理工程施工技术规范 DB50_T 989-2020 重庆.pdf VIP
文档评论(0)